Fed: Lena to become dive wreck

A Russian-owned boat seized after its crew was caught poaching the protected Patagoniantoothfish in Australian waters in February is to be sunk for a dive wreck.

The 55-metre LENA has been towed today from Fremantle to Bunbury, 180 kilometres southof Perth, where it will be stripped and sunk next year.

The boat was confiscated by the commonwealth after its skipper and two crew memberswere convicted and fined $100,000 for illegally fishing 80 tonnes - or $1 million worth- of Patagonian toothfish.

Federal Fisheries Minister IAN MACDONALD says the boat will become a valuable tourist attraction.

Mr MACDONALD says today's announcement sends a clear message to pirate fishermen thatthe government will do everything in its power to prevent seized boats from ever operatingillegally in Australian waters again.
